Catherine Fulop showed her joy at becoming a grandmother and revealed details about the birth of Gia

Catherine Fulop expresses her excitement about becoming a grandmother and shares details regarding the early birth of her granddaughter, Gia.

Catherine Fulop, a Venezuelan actress and television host, shared her joy about becoming a grandmother following the early birth of her granddaughter, Gia, the first child of Oriana Sabatini and Paulo Dybala. The birth, which took place earlier than the expected mid-March date, has been a hot topic in both Argentina and Italy, where Fulop lives with the football star, Paulo Dybala. Fulop took to her social media platforms, particularly her Instagram account with 4.2 million followers, to announce the joyous news and celebrate this special moment in her family's life.

Fulop's Instagram stories featured a heartfelt announcement that included a wooden plaque saying "Hello World," creatively showcasing the arrival of Gia. The actress promised to spoil her granddaughter with love, further indicating her enthusiasm for her new role.
